“Missing”

Part of DC's 1994 "Zero Hour" initiative, this special issue promises "The Beginning of Tomorrow!" right on the cover — and Howard Porter and Robert Jones deliver on that energy with a striking image of the Ray surging forward in a blaze of fire and light, fists crackling as a city grid stretches out far below him. The dark, striped costume cuts a bold silhouette against that roiling amber explosion, giving the whole image a raw, kinetic momentum. With Christopher Priest writing and Howard Porter on interiors, The Ray #0 is a fine jumping-on point for anyone curious about this light-powered hero.
